| Obverse description | Laureate head of Emperor Galba facing right, with short hair and aged features rendered in a realistic, veristic portrait style typical of the Julio-Claudian tradition. The emperor is depicted with a draped bust, the drapery visible at the truncation of the neck. The circumferential legend SER GALBA IMPERATOR runs around the periphery in Latin capitals, identifying the emperor by his full name and supreme military title. |
